How We Tackle Behind Wall Water Damage: A Step-by-Step Approach

When water hides behind your walls, it’s crucial to have a methodical approach. Cutting corners here can lead to lingering moisture, mold, and a recurrence of the problem. Our team follows a proven process designed to locate, extract, dry, and restore affected areas efficiently and effectively. We believe in transparent communication throughout the entire process, so you always know what’s happening. Our goal is to get your home back to normal with minimal inconvenience.

1. Emergency Water Extraction

First, we need to get the standing water out. Our crews use specialized pumps and extraction tools to remove as much water as possible from cavities and subflooring. This step is critical to prevent further saturation and damage to your home’s structure. It usually takes a few hours depending on the amount of water.

2. Moisture Detection and Assessment

This is where our expertise really shines. We use advanced tools like infrared cameras and moisture meters to accurately pinpoint the extent of the water damage behind your walls. This allows us to understand exactly which materials are affected and how deeply, ensuring we don’t miss any hidden pockets of moisture. This phase is key for accurate damage mapping and typically takes a few hours.

3. Controlled Demolition and Access

To properly dry and access the wet materials, we often need to carefully remove sections of drywall or other finishes. We do this with precision to create necessary openings, minimizing the mess and making it easier to treat the affected areas. Our goal is to create targeted access points, not to tear down your whole house. This can take a few hours to a full day.

4. Advanced Drying and Dehumidification

Once we have access, we set up specialized drying equipment. This includes industrial-grade air movers and dehumidifiers designed to pull moisture out of the air and building materials. We monitor humidity levels closely to ensure a thorough and efficient drying process. This can take anywhere from a few days to over a week, depending on the severity.

5. Mold Prevention and Remediation

Hidden moisture is a breeding ground for mold. As part of our drying process, we often apply antimicrobial treatments to prevent mold growth and, if necessary, perform mold remediation. We want to ensure your home is not only dry but also healthy and safe for your family. This step is integrated into the drying process and can add a day or two.

Warning Signs You Need Behind Wall Water Damage Restoration

Catching water damage early, even when it’s hidden, can save you a lot of headaches and money down the line. Your home often gives you clues if something’s not right. Paying attention to these subtle signs can help you prevent a small leak from becoming a major restoration project.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

A persistent, damp, or musty smell, especially in specific rooms or near certain walls, is a strong indicator of hidden moisture and potential mold growth. This is often the first noticeable clue.

Discolored Walls or Ceilings

Look for new water stains, bubbling paint, or peeling wallpaper. Even small spots can signal water seeping from behind the wall, indicating a slow but steady leak.

Soft or Warped Flooring Near Walls

If your baseboards or the flooring directly adjacent to a wall feel soft, spongy, or look warped, water may be seeping down from behind the wall and affecting the subfloor. This suggests significant moisture intrusion.

Unexplained High Water Bills

A sudden, unexplained increase in your water bill can mean there’s a hidden leak somewhere in your plumbing system, likely inside your walls. This is a clear financial warning.

Sounds of Dripping or Running Water

If you can hear faint dripping, trickling, or running water sounds when no faucets or appliances are on, it’s almost certainly a leak within your walls. Don’t ignore these audible signals.

Mold or Mildew Spots

Any visible mold or mildew growth on walls, especially in corners or near the floor, points to a moisture problem that’s been present long enough for mold to develop. This is a health hazard.

Behind Wall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Suspecting a small leak behind a wall No Yes Without specialized detection tools, you risk missing the true extent of the damage.
Noticing a musty smell Maybe (for initial investigation) Yes A smell means moisture is present; a pro can find the source and dry it properly.
Seeing a small water stain on drywall No Yes The stain is just the tip of the iceberg; the real damage is behind the wall.
Dealing with a burst pipe behind a wall Absolutely Not Yes This is a major event requiring immediate, professional extraction and drying equipment.
Needing to dry out wall cavities No Yes Specialized equipment is needed to dry materials behind walls effectively and prevent mold.
Repairing minor cosmetic damage after drying Yes (if you’re handy) No (for repairs only) Once the water damage is professionally handled, cosmetic repairs can often be done by a homeowner.

For behind wall water damage, especially when dealing with plumbing leaks or extensive moisture, calling a professional is almost always the right choice. Behind Wall Water Damage Restoration Cost In Otay Mesa, CA

The cost for behind wall water damage restoration in Otay Mesa, CA, can vary significantly. Factors like the size of the affected area, the severity of the water intrusion, and the type of building materials involved all play a role. These figures are estimates and a proper on-site assessment is needed for an accurate quote.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Leak Detection & Assessment $300 – $1,000 Complexity of the leak and the extent of suspected damage influence the time needed.
Water Extraction from Wall Cavities $500 – $2,500 The volume of water to be removed and the accessibility of the affected areas matter.
Controlled Demolition for Access $400 – $1,500 The amount of drywall or other finishes needing removal directly impacts labor costs.
Structural Drying (Air Movers & Dehumidifiers) $800 – $3,000 The number of pieces of equipment needed and the duration of the drying process are key.
Antimicrobial Treatment $300 – $900 The size of the treated area and the type of treatment applied will affect the price.
Mold Remediation (if necessary) $1,000 – $4,000+ The severity and spread of mold growth are the primary cost drivers.

Common Questions About Behind Wall Water Damage Restoration

How do you find water behind walls without tearing everything down?

We use specialized equipment like moisture meters and infrared cameras to detect hidden water. These tools help us pinpoint the exact location and extent of the damage without unnecessary demolition. Our goal is to be as minimally invasive as possible while ensuring thorough assessment.

How long does it take to dry out walls after a leak?

The drying process can take anywhere from three days to two weeks, sometimes longer, depending on how much water is present and how saturated the materials are. We use powerful air movers and dehumidifiers to speed up the process and ensure the wall cavities are completely dry.

Is behind wall water damage dangerous for my health?

Yes, it can be. Hidden moisture creates an ideal environment for mold and mildew to grow, which can release spores into the air. Inhaling these spores can lead to respiratory problems and allergic reactions. That’s why prompt professional drying and remediation are so important for your home’s indoor air quality.

What kind of equipment do you use to remove water from behind walls?

We use industrial-strength pumps and extractors for initial water removal. For drying, we deploy high-velocity air movers to circulate air and specialized dehumidifiers to pull moisture from the air and building materials. We also use moisture meters and thermal imaging cameras to monitor the drying progress and ensure materials reach a safe moisture content.

Can I prevent water damage behind my walls?

Regular maintenance is key. Periodically inspect your plumbing, especially under sinks and around toilets, for any signs of leaks or corrosion. Ensure your roof and gutters are in good repair to prevent water intrusion from the outside. Addressing small drips or condensation issues promptly can prevent them from becoming bigger problems behind your walls.
